Предмет: Информатика, автор: kkkkvvvvvvvv

заполните массив натуральными числами в обратном порядке, начиная со значения x, введённого с клавиатуры. последний раз элемент должен быть равен x, предпоследний равен x-1 и т. д.
заполните массив степенями числа 2(от 2¹ до 2^n), так чтобы элемент индексом i был равен 2^i.
пайтон.

Ответы

Автор ответа: Аноним
1

Ответ:

Заполнение массива натуральными числами в обратном порядке, начиная со значения x:

n = int(input("Введите размер массива: "))

x = int(input("Введите начальное значение: "))

arr = [0] * n

for i in range(n):

   arr[i] = x

   x -= 1

print(arr)

Заполнение массива степенями числа 2:

n = int(input("Введите размер массива: "))

arr = [0] * n

for i in range(n):

   arr[i] = 2 ** i

print(arr)

Объяснение:

Похожие вопросы